Choose from two amazing tours

Cathedral Cove

Covering over 25km of iconic Coromandel hotspots between Whitianga and Hot Water Beach, this 2 to 3 hour trip is rich in history and photo opportunities.

Cruise along the Orua coastline, soaking up 360-degree views of blowholes, sea caves and the iconic Cathedral Cove.

Pass through Te Whanganui-O-Hei Marine Reserve and visit the Orua Sea Cave – one of New Zealand’s largest.

Waitaia

If you’re looking for something a bit different, head out to explore the picturesque Waitaia coast.

This rugged volcanic coastline is covered in native bush. It’s also home to spectacular sea caves, towering volcanic arches and seasonal wildlife.

Get ready to explore the Waitaia Sea Caves, visit the spectacular Needle Rock, get up close at the Whiskey Falls and swim the Devil’s Arches.

Plus, they’ll even throw in a stop at the amazing Cathedral Cove along the way, so you don’t need to choose one over the other.
